> On Mon, Aug 03, 2009 at 02:13:16PM +0200, Takashi Iwai wrote:
>> Lukasz Stelmach wrote:
>
>>> No worries ;) there is --with(out)--dbus option for configure to
>>> disable all this code which is enough for initrd because most often
>>> (AFAIK) initrd binaries are not the same that in the live system.
>
>> Usually same binaries are used for initrd nowadays in many distros.
>> So, configure option doesn't help.
>
>> And, I really prefer this as a separate daemon, so it be as small as
>> possible. Seeing amixer as a daemon is somewhat strange...
>
> I tend to agree, merging it into amixer seems kind of arbatrary. Such a
> daemon (and its dbus interface) may also be useful for handling things
> like scenario management so I can see it growing over time.
